The Nigerian Navy has detained eight individuals attempting to stow away aboard the MSC Katyani vessel in a bid to illegally migrate to Europe.
The incident occurred off the coast of Lagos State on Friday, targeting illegal migration routes.
In a statement released on Wednesday, the Nigerian Navy confirmed that the suspects were handed over to the Deputy Superintendent of Immigration, Dalhatu Musa, at the Lagos Ports/Marine Command in Apapa, Lagos.
The statement reads, “On Friday, 17 January 2025, Nigerian Navy Ship BEECROFT apprehended 8 suspected stowaways onboard MSC KATYANI with the intention to illegally migrate to Europe.
Consequently, the suspects were handed over to the Deputy Superintendent of Immigration Dalhatu Musa of Lagos Ports/Marine Command, Apapa Lagos.”
The arrested individuals were believed to have planned to reach Europe by stowing away on the commercial vessel, which was en route to international waters.
